The EURO 2003 Auto Festival will be held on 17-19 October 2003 at the BMW Zentrum Visitors Center adjacent to BMW Manufacturing Corporation's plant site between Greenville and Spartanburg, South Carolina USA. This will be the 8th Annual EURO Auto Festival. DeLoreans usually have a respectful showing... I know I'll be there! (I'm towards the bottom)